Laird Technologies - Antennas

Laird Technologies - Antennas is a leading semiconductor manufacturer that was initially established in the year 1991. The company's headquarters are located in Earth City, Missouri, United States, from where it operates and serves its global clientele base. Since its inception, Laird Technologies - Antennas has been recognized for its innovative contributions to the semiconductor industry and its unwavering commitment to quality.

One of the main product categories for Laird Technologies - Antennas is their robust collection of high-performance antennas. These antennas are designed for a variety of applications, ranging from automotive to telecommunications, industrial, and consumer electronics. In addition to antennas, the firm specializes in manufacturing wireless and thermal management solutions. Laird Technologies - Antennas remains dedicated to delivering products that offer superior performance, reliability, and value to its customers.
